Marine canvas doesn’t fail all at once. It starts with small tears, worn seams, broken stitching, or fraying around high-stress areas. This kit gives boat owners the right materials and a step-by-step PDF guide to make strong, waterproof repairs that last.
It is designed specifically for saltwater environments and UV exposure, not household fabric fixes.
What’s included (physical parts)
Canvas repair patches (marine-grade, UV-resistant)
Heavy-duty UV-resistant polyester thread
Sail/Canvas needles
Industrial fabric adhesive (marine-safe)
Seam sealer
Reinforcement tape for high-stress corners
Snap fastener replacements (with setting tool)
Zipper lubricant
Alcohol wipes for surface prep

What it does NOT fix
Large structural tears, rotten canvas, or heavily sun-baked fabric that crumbles. The guide explains when replacement is smarter.
Recommended skill level
Beginner friendly. No sewing machine required, but basic hand-sewing is helpful.
